Getting Started: Input Options for Your Edits

To begin, you need to gather your primary assets: a song and optionally, visuals. Sleepy Motion allows you to upload a song and generate a lyric video with minimal effort. Here’s how:

  • Upload Your Song: When you drop in your audio track, the engine automatically transcribes the lyrics in over 90 languages. If you have specific lyrics, you can paste them for a perfect match that syncs with the beat.
  • Choose Your Visual Options: You can add images and videos to enrich your project, but at minimum, you need a song. Adding a cover image and up to 5 additional images is optional but can enhance the visual appeal.
  • Select Your Mode: Decide between an audio-driven visualizer, a visualizer with a cover image, or a comprehensive visualizer that includes a background image. Each option provides a unique way to present your content.

Audio-Driven Vs. Masked Edits

Audio-Driven Visualizers

In this mode, your song takes center stage. The engine builds a beat-reactive edit that syncs perfectly with the lyrics. The visuals respond to the music, creating an engaging experience for viewers. Popular among TikTok creators, this method is straightforward and requires no additional editing skills. Just upload your song, and let the software do the work.

Masked Edits for Faceless Content

For creators looking to maintain anonymity or repurpose existing footage, masked edits are a game-changer. Here’s how it works:

  • Upload Your Video: Choose any footage you want to transform.
  • Select the Masking Style:
- Masked Light: The subject remains visible while the background is replaced with the audio visualizer.

- Masked Medium: The subject becomes a silhouette filled with the visualizer, creating a striking contrast.

- Masked Heavy: This option layers multiple visuals for a dynamic, beat-driven edit.

With these options, you can take any clip and turn it into a faceless music-driven edit without showing your face. This method has gained traction for faceless channels on platforms like YouTube, allowing creators to maintain privacy while still producing captivating content.

A Note on Music Rights

When creating edits with existing songs, it’s crucial to navigate music rights thoughtfully. While lyric videos and fan edits can be transformative and creative, the rights to music vary widely depending on the song, region, and platform. Always seek to use music you own or have a license for, along with footage you have permission to use. This practice not only respects the original creators but also safeguards your content against potential copyright issues. Remember that platforms have their own systems for handling music rights, which can affect your video's visibility and monetization options.
